Способы решения проблем с синхронизацией данных в Yandex Browser

Первичная диагностика и устранение сбоев синхронизации

Самый быстрый способ восстановить работу синхронизации в Яндекс Браузере — выйти из аккаунта и авторизоваться заново, что принудительно обновляет токены сессии. Если проблема сохраняется, проверьте стабильность интернет-соединения и отсутствие блокировок со стороны антивирусного ПО или корпоративных прокси-серверов. Регулярная очистка кэша данных синхронизации часто устраняет конфликты, возникающие при передаче зашифрованных пакетов между сервером и локальным хранилищем.

Проверка статуса учетной записи и параметров профиля

Синхронизация данных невозможна, если профиль пользователя находится в состоянии «неактивен» или истек срок действия авторизационного токена. В первую очередь откройте настройки браузера и убедитесь, что индикатор статуса синхронизации подсвечен зеленым цветом. Если статус помечен как «Ошибка» или «Требуется повторный вход», система не сможет передавать закладки, пароли и историю посещений на сервер.

Частой причиной сбоев становится конфликт данных при использовании одного и того же аккаунта на нескольких устройствах с разными версиями браузера. Убедитесь, что на всех гаджетах установлена актуальная сборка Яндекс Браузера. Разрыв в версиях может приводить к ошибкам десериализации данных, когда сервер не понимает структуру пакетов, отправленных устаревшим клиентом.

Алгоритм принудительного сброса настроек синхронизации

Если стандартный выход из аккаунта не помогает, необходимо выполнить полную переинициализацию службы синхронизации. Следуйте этой инструкции для очистки локальных метаданных:

  1. Перейдите в настройки браузера через меню или введите в адресную строку browser://settings/.
  2. Найдите раздел «Синхронизация» и нажмите кнопку «Настроить синхронизацию».
  3. Отключите все пункты (пароли, история, закладки), чтобы очистить локальные хвосты конфигурации.
  4. Закройте браузер и удалите содержимое папки «Sync Data», расположенной в директории профиля пользователя (обычно это путь AppDataLocalYandexYandexBrowserUser DataDefault).
  5. Запустите браузер и выполните повторную авторизацию, выбрав опцию «Синхронизировать данные с сервером».

Важно: перед удалением папки Sync Data убедитесь, что все актуальные данные успешно переданы на сервер через личный кабинет (passport.yandex.ru), иначе локальные изменения будут безвозвратно утеряны при принудительной синхронизации.

Влияние сетевых экранов и расширений на передачу данных

Синхронизация использует протоколы HTTPS для передачи зашифрованных данных, поэтому любые средства фильтрации трафика могут блокировать запросы к серверам Яндекса. Расширения-блокировщики рекламы или антивирусные модули с функцией глубокого анализа SSL-трафика часто ошибочно помечают пакеты синхронизации как подозрительные.

Анализ сетевых ограничений

  • Отключите сторонние VPN-клиенты и прокси-серверы, которые могут менять IP-адрес или подменять сертификаты безопасности.
  • Добавьте домены синхронизации в список исключений вашего брандмауэра.
  • Проверьте файл hosts в системе на наличие записей, блокирующих доступ к серверам yandex.ru или passport.yandex.ru.

Если вы используете корпоративную сеть, доступ к службе синхронизации может быть ограничен системным администратором на уровне шлюза. В таких ситуациях браузер будет выдавать ошибку «Превышено время ожидания» или «Ошибка соединения с сервером» даже при исправной работе интернета.

Устранение проблем с шифрованием и мастер-паролем

Использование мастер-пароля для защиты сохраненных данных добавляет уровень сложности при синхронизации. Если на одном устройстве мастер-пароль изменен, а на другом — нет, произойдет конфликт ключей шифрования. Браузер не сможет расшифровать полученные с сервера данные, что приведет к остановке процесса.

Для исправления этой ситуации необходимо:

  1. На устройстве, где данные отображаются корректно, временно отключить мастер-пароль в настройках безопасности.
  2. Дождаться завершения полной синхронизации всех данных с сервером.
  3. На остальных устройствах выполнить выход из аккаунта и повторный вход, чтобы обновить локальную базу паролей.
  4. После успешного объединения данных снова установить мастер-пароль, если это необходимо.

Конфликты данных в локальной базе профиля

Иногда база данных SQLite, в которой браузер хранит закладки и историю, повреждается из-за некорректного завершения работы программы или сбоев питания. В этом случае служба синхронизации пытается отправить поврежденные записи, получает отказ от сервера и уходит в бесконечный цикл попыток соединения.

Диагностика поврежденной базы

Если вы заметили, что закладки дублируются или исчезают сразу после добавления, проблема кроется в локальном индексе. Попробуйте выполнить экспорт закладок в HTML-файл, удалить их в браузере и затем импортировать обратно. Этот процесс заставит движок синхронизации переиндексировать записи и отправить корректные данные на сервер.

Также стоит проверить папку профиля на наличие файлов с расширением .journal или .tmp. Их наличие в активной рабочей директории свидетельствует о том, что транзакция записи в базу данных не была завершена корректно. Удаление таких временных файлов при закрытом браузере часто решает проблему «зависшей» синхронизации.

Ограничения при работе с большим объемом данных

При наличии десятков тысяч закладок или огромной истории посещений за несколько лет, процесс первичной синхронизации может занимать длительное время. Пользователи часто ошибочно принимают это за сбой, закрывая браузер в процессе передачи данных. Оставьте браузер открытым на 15–20 минут после входа в аккаунт, не выполняя активных действий в сети.

Проверить прогресс можно через внутреннюю страницу browser://sync-internals/. В разделе «Traffic» отображаются текущие запросы к серверу, а в «Type Info» можно увидеть статус каждого типа данных (закладки, пароли, автозаполнение). Если в колонке «Status» вы видите сообщения об ошибках типа «Conflict» или «Transient Error», это означает, что сервер временно перегружен или данные требуют ручного разрешения конфликтов.

Технические аспекты работы службы синхронизации

Яндекс Браузер использует архитектуру на основе Chromium, где за синхронизацию отвечает модуль Sync Service. Этот модуль работает в фоновом режиме и обменивается данными через специальные API-эндпоинты. Любое вмешательство в работу этого процесса через сторонний софт для «оптимизации ПК» или «очистки реестра» может привести к повреждению ключей шифрования, хранящихся в системном хранилище (Windows Credential Manager или Keychain в macOS).

Если вы подозреваете, что системные ключи повреждены:

  • В Windows откройте «Диспетчер учетных данных» (Credential Manager).
  • Найдите записи, связанные с Yandex, и удалите их.
  • Перезапустите браузер и авторизуйтесь заново.

Это заставит систему создать новую пару ключей шифрования для вашего профиля, что решит проблему невозможности доступа к зашифрованным данным, накопленным на сервере.

Решение проблем с пустыми данными после синхронизации

Бывают ситуации, когда после входа в аккаунт браузер остается пустым, хотя на сервере данные присутствуют. Чаще всего это происходит из-за того, что локальный профиль был создан раньше, чем произошла авторизация, и браузер начал «смешивать» пустую локальную базу с серверной. Чтобы избежать потери данных, всегда сначала авторизуйтесь в чистом профиле, а затем позволяйте браузеру вытянуть данные из облака.

Если данные все же не появились, проверьте настройки синхронизации: возможно, в меню «Настроить синхронизацию» сняты галочки с определенных категорий данных. Иногда после обновления браузера эти настройки сбрасываются по умолчанию, и синхронизация конкретных типов данных отключается автоматически.

Специфика синхронизации на мобильных устройствах

Мобильная версия Яндекс Браузера имеет свои особенности передачи данных, связанные с экономией трафика и режимом энергосбережения. Если синхронизация не работает на смартфоне, проверьте системные настройки: не включен ли режим «Экономия заряда», который ограничивает фоновую активность приложений. Также убедитесь, что приложению предоставлены все необходимые разрешения в настройках Android или iOS, включая доступ к сети в фоновом режиме.

Принудительная остановка приложения через настройки системы Android и очистка кэша (не данных!) приложения часто помогает сбросить «зависшие» процессы синхронизации без потери пользовательских настроек.

Если синхронизация закладок не происходит, попробуйте создать новую тестовую закладку на мобильном устройстве. Если она появится в десктопной версии, значит, канал связи работает, а проблема заключается в конкретных записях, которые не могут пройти валидацию на стороне сервера.


Добавить комментарий